  • Page 180 of Y14.5-2009
    SECTION 9-2
    Runout is the tol. used to control the function relationship of 1 or more features to a datum axis established from a datum feature.
  • Shlag, the question posed is worded rather oddly. "Can runout be measured using a line drawn between to circles?"
    The answer is No. Runout cannot be MEASURED using a line. Never ever. Runout must be measured as we've both clarified.

    DATUM ALIGNMENT can be established with a line drawn between two circles, then runout can be measured circumferentially, relative to that line...
    --you can't MEASURE (aka quantify variation numerically) runout with an axis line.
